The Biphasic Waveform Defibrillator Market was valued at approximately USD 1.5 billion in 2022. It is anticipated to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 6.5%, reaching an estimated USD 2.1 billion by 2027. This robust growth can be attributed to the increasing pr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, advancements in defibrillation technology, and the rising awareness about the importance of early defibrillation in saving lives during cardiac emergencies. Additionally, the growing investment in healthcare infrastructure, particularly in developing regions, is expected to further stimulate market growth.

A biphasic waveform defibrillator is a type of defibrillator that delivers electrical therapy in two phases.

The different types of biphasic waveform defibrillator devices available in the market include manual defibrillators, automated external defibrillators (AEDs), and wearable defibrillators.
Regulatory requirements for biphasic waveform defibrillator devices vary by region, but generally include certification from regulatory authorities such as the FDA in the United States and the CE mark in Europe.
